Sub Scandal Figure Held After Violation

subA Greek businessman who was out on bail after being charged in a submarine scandal was arrested in northeast Attica on Jan. 16 for violating the restrictive conditions and the terms of his temporary release. Alexandros Avataggelos has been accused of money laundering through his companies, according to Eniko.gr. He had been set free on a bail of 500,000 euros and conditions that included a prohibition on leaving the country and a requirement he check in to a police station regularly. There were no details on what conditions he violated. The incident came 10 days after a convicted November 17 terrorist walked away from a furlough he was granted even though he was serving six life sentences for six assassinations.
